THCA, or tetrahydrocannabinolic acid, is a non-psychoactive compound found in raw cannabis plants. Unlike THC, THCA does not produce a high when consumed. Instead, it offers a range of potential health benefits, including anti-inflammatory and analgesic properties. These characteristics make THCA flower an intriguing option for those seeking relief from muscle soreness.
THCA interacts with the body's endocannabinoid system, which plays a role in regulating pain and inflammation. By binding to specific receptors, THCA may help reduce inflammation and alleviate pain, making it a promising candidate for managing muscle soreness.

For those interested in trying THCA flower for muscle soreness, several methods of consumption are available. Each method offers unique benefits and can be tailored to individual preferences.
Consuming raw THCA flower is one of the most direct ways to experience its benefits. This method preserves the compound's natural properties and can be easily incorporated into smoothies or salads.
THCA tinctures and oils offer a convenient way to consume the compound. These products can be taken sublingually or added to food and beverages for easy integration into daily routines.
For targeted relief, THCA-infused creams and balms can be applied directly to sore muscles. This method allows for localized treatment and can be particularly effective for specific areas of discomfort.
